Modern car keys programmed aren't the basic pieces of metal you can cut at the kiosks at malls. They are made up of a sophisticated piece of electronic equipment known as transponder chips that need to be programmed to work with your specific vehicle's security system. Most automotive locksmiths can perform this task, therefore it is recommended to leave it to them.

If your car keys reprogramming is equipped with an immobilizer system, you will need a special key with a built-in transponder chip to activate it. This type of key is required by a majority of owners to disable their car's anti-theft system which was made mandatory in 1995. Locksmiths are able to quickly copy and program this type of key, but you'll have to call them if you need it done outside of normal business hours.

Another option is to purchase an inexpensive, blank key and attempt to program it yourself. This is a risky option that requires a good understanding of electronics. It's worth trying if you're not willing to pay for professional services.

You can find blank keys for cars in most auto parts stores as well as some pharmacies. You can buy a keyfob from a major retailer, or even online stores that specialize in automotive technology. Some auto parts stores also offer key programming in-store. These services are typically provided an hour before the store closes, if an employee with training is present. However, some brands prohibit this practice and demand that a dealership be the sole one to make new keys for their vehicles.

If you have a leased vehicle, make sure you check your policy documentation prior to getting the new key fob programmed. The contract may require you go to the dealership to get the new key programmed, or even prohibit it. This will prevent you from making costly mistakes that could lead to the end of your lease.
